Zinsbouw

Dutch sentence structure follows specific word order rules. The verb always takes the second position in a main clause โ€” this is called the V2 rule.

Key rules for Sentence Structure

Hoofdzin โ€” Main Clause

In a regular sentence, the subject comes first, then the verb, then the rest.

Inversie โ€” Inversion

When another element (time, place, adverb) starts the sentence, the verb stays in position 2 โ€” subject and verb swap.

Open Vraag โ€” Open Question

Questions starting with a question word (wie, wat, waar, wanneer, hoe). Verb stays in position 2.
